Indispensable in professional marine energy systems, the Isolation Transformer eliminates any electrical continuity between shore power and the boat. The shore power is fed to the primary side of the transformer and the ship is connected to the secondary. The Isolation Transformer completely isolates the boat from the shore ground. By connecting all metal parts to the neutral output on the secondary side of the transformer, a GFCI will trip or a fuse will blow in case of a short circuit. It is essential for safety and eliminates the need for galvanic isolators and polarity alarms.
Soft start is a standard feature of a Victron Energy isolation transformer. It will prevent the shore power fuse from blowing due to the inrush current of the transformer, which would otherwise occur. It is also recommended, for optimal safety, to connect the secondary neutral of the transformer to ground when the boat is out of the water.
European isolation tranformer
This model does not comply with ABYC standard 11.7.1.3 regarding shield fault current but complies with appropriate European standards Accepts 50 or 60 Hz inputs in 230 volt configurations and can be used as a step up or step down transformer as well as a straight through isolation transformer.
